After signing from Mainz in 2016, Karius has played 26 times. This campaign, six of those have come in the Champions League as Klopp likes to rotate his goalkeepers. With three 2017/2018 Premier League appearances under his belt, it’s clear that his gaffer still hasn’t chosen who is better out of Karius and Simon Mignolet.

Last season the German played 10 times in the league, but there are lingering doubt about his suitability to the competition, and he certainly hasn’t shown enough quality over a sustained period of time to impress the doubters.
